Pokémon Exalted Emerald

This is a decompilation of Pokémon Emerald with various patches applied to update game mechanics. For the original, unmodified decompile, check out https://github.com/pret/pokeemerald For DizzyEgg's modifications, check out https://github.com/DizzyEggg/pokeemerald

Major changes

  • Updates moves, abilities and mechanics (DizzyEgg's battle engine upgrade)
  • Adds items from newer generations (DizzyEgg's item expansion)
  • Updates pokemon movesets (level up, egg)
  • Updates breeding mechanics (Destiny Knot, Oval Charm, ability inheriting)
  • Updates TMs/HMs to OrAs TMs/HMs (new and updated TMs can generally be found in the same locations as in OrAs)
  • Replaces the battle style setting with a difficulty setting (EASY = SHIFT, NORMAL = SET, HARD = SET with every trainer using the best AI and scaled Pokémon levels)
  • Adds optional Nuzlocke mode and randomizer (can be enabled in the truck after starting a new game)
  • Adds a chance for wild double battles (using sweet scent causes wild encounters to always be double battles)
  • Adds hidden abilities (Pokémon with HA can be found in the safari zone or rarely in wild double battles)
  • Updates EXP and EXP share mechanics (All Pokémon receive full EXP)
  • Makes all regular Pokémon obtainable (legendaries to be done)
  • Improves AI code to allow AI to predict moves and switch Pokémon if appropriate
  • Increases rematchable trainers' party sizes and levels over time
  • Changes HM mechanics: Pokémon don't have to learn the HM to use it, they just have to be compatible

Minor and QoL changes

  • Lets you use a new repel directly after the old one runs out (DizzyEgg's repel)
  • Lets you use the running shoes indoors
  • Simplifies fishing, the first time you press A in time, you reel in the Pokémon
  • Adds evolution stones to the Lilicove shop
  • Removes the extra overwrite question when saving the game
  • Gives you X Premier Balls for any Pokéball purchase where X is the amount of balls bought / 10
  • Enables the national dex from the beginning
  • Changes in-game trade Pokémon to more reasonable ones and fixes their abysmal IVs
  • Adds a scientist to the Devon Corporation building that can simulate Pokémon trades to evolve trade evolution Pokémon
  • Makes the Synchronize ability affect static encounters and gifted Pokémon
  • Updates the shiny chance to newer generations chance
  • Opens up the complete safari zone from the beginning and removes the step limit
  • Safari zone Pokémon have a minimum of 3 perfect IVs and a chance for their hidden ability
  • All legendary and gifted Pokémon have a minimum of 4 perfect IVs
  • Improves the IV rater to tell multiple maxed and also 0 stats
  • Allows the move relearner to teach moves from higher levels and makes move relearning a one time payment
  • Lets you remove HMs at any time and make TMs reusable
  • Allows some bug types to learn Fly
  • Makes move tutors reusable
  • Changes the mirage island mechanic and adds multiple mirage locations where one of them is always active
  • Increases view distance when not using flash and removes the overlay completely when using flash
  • Updates berry yield and grow time to OrAs values
  • Allows you to also get the other bike once you beat the E4
  • Increases all bag item slot limits to 999 (like for berries)
  • Increases bag capacity
  • Adds a Pokéball collector to Sootopolis that gifts Johto Pokéballs
  • Adds a land connection between the two halves of Sootopolis
  • Adds option to invert B button behavior (always run)
  • Adds a post-game rival battle to Route 103
  • Allows fainted Pokémon to gain EXP
  • Add quick switching Pokémon in the party menu using select button (Lunos)

Cosmetic changes

  • Expands Mauville City to make it more lively
  • Changes Mossdeep City music to use Dewford Town music (Rustboro music is overused)
  • Makes the name rater actually rate your nicknames
  • Makes NPCs use different Pokéballs depending on their trainer class
  • Tweaks existing and adds new window borders
